    I bought a liberty 40 for like $2k delivered to my driveway. I used 1.5” pvc and rolled it into the basement It’s not bolted down but I reframed and hung a steel door from basement into garage that it can’t fit through.
    Put a dry stick in it for moisture control.

    We have more than one safe, but our best by far is the biggest safe that was made by National Security Safe Co. It weigh's 1650 lbs. empty so it's not bolted down. All of ours are key and rotary dial open type. I don't trust the touch pads.

    Academy has the Cannon's on sale for 599 I looked at them last weekend and was not impressed at all. The interior was really cheap looking and the bottom was tack welded. The door had alot of play in it too. I really wanted to like them and come home with it but I could not.
